SOURCE: cabin Air Filter
Open the glove box
Remove all of the contents in the glove box
On the right side, dis-engage the rod going to the split plastic pin on the glove box door
Squeeze both other sides of the glove box to defeat the stops that keeps the glove box from falling open
Observe the box in the area vacated by letting the glove box drop down, this is the heater box
Locate a rectangular cover (approx 7 " x 2"), it is located on the face of the box; facing you.
Pull this cover out towards you, the cabin air filter is located in the tray that is connected to this rectangular cover.

SOURCE: cabin air filter
Purchase a Purolator Cabin Filter for your Impala. It comes with complete instructions. The filter is located below the windshield, passenger side. The black plastic cover must be removed to access the filter. You simply raise the hood and remove 3 plastic clips, and the washer hose from it's holders. This will allow you to remove the plastic cover over the filter

SOURCE: trying to change the cabin air filter
1. Open glove box
2. Unhook elastic retainer on right side
3. Locate the two "stop tabs", one on the upper left and the other on the right side. Push both to the left to clear their stops and the glove box will swing down, allowing access to the filter cover.
